Abstract

A buffer structure of a treadmill includes a load board, two side rods and two tooth racks. The two side rods includes a pair of hand wheels and a pair of gear wheels which are respectively located central sections of the two side rods and connected by a link rod, and a pair of fixing rods disposed under the link rod. The two tooth racks includes toothed portions at upper ends thereof to mesh with the gear wheels, fixing posts at inner sides thereof for insertion of the hollow cylinders, fixing bolts screwed to the fixing posts, and two slots at two sides of the fixing bolts. The two slide bolts are inserted through two through holes of the two side rods and the two slots and connected with nuts and washers. A gap is formed between the tooth racks and the side rods for slide.

What is claimed is: 
     
         1 . A buffer structure of a treadmill, comprising a load board, two side rods and two tooth racks;
 the load board comprising a pair of buffer units under two sides thereof, the buffer units comprising a plurality of buffer members to lean against upper ends of hollow cylinders of the tooth racks;   the two side rods comprising a pair of hand wheels and a pair of gear wheels which are respectively located at outer and inner sides of central sections of the two side rods, a link rod connecting the hand wheels and the gear wheels and a pair of fixing rods disposed under the link rod, the fixing rods each having two through holes;   the two tooth racks comprising toothed portions at upper ends thereof to mesh with the gear wheels, fixing posts at inner sides thereof for insertion of the hollow cylinders, fixing bolts screwed to the fixing posts, and two slots at two sides of the fixing bolts, the two slide bolts being inserted through the two through holes of the two side rods and the two slots and connected with nuts and washers, a gap being formed between the tooth racks and the side rods for slide;   thereby, by turning either of the hand wheels, the link rod and the two gear wheels being driven to mesh with the two tooth portions so that the two tooth racks being slid through the two slots, the hollow cylinders being moved to be under the desired buffer members.   
     
     
         2 . The buffer structure of a treadmill as claimed in  claim 1 , wherein the link rod is connected between the two fixing posts, the link rod having threaded sections at two ends thereof for connection of the two fixing posts and stop walls to confine rotation of the hollow cylinders. 
     
     
         3 . The buffer structure of a treadmill as claimed in  claim 1 , wherein a motor is provided at one end of the buffer unit under either side of the load board close to the gear wheel of the corresponding side rod, the motor comprising a transmission gear wheel to mesh with the corresponding gear wheel. 
     
     
         4 . The buffer structure of a treadmill as claimed in  claim 1 , wherein the slide bolts are provided with sleeves to slide in the slots with ease.
